SAMHSA’s NREPP: Kognito At-Risk For College Students

The federal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) released this document on Kognito At-Risk for College Students. Kognito At-Risk for College Students has been included in the National Registry of Evidence-based Programs and Practices. This document provides an overview of theAt-Risk for College Students, program outcomes, a review of program literature, and a readiness for dissemination score.
